Stallion’s Spirit Game

Stallion’s Spirit Stallion’s Spirit is a wild west horseback racing game. Compete with other riders, use any means to become the first one to cross the finish line. It is an intense 3D horse racing game. You start with only 1 available horse, but you can unlock more as you win the races. It takes good control to avoid every obstacle and be the first one to reach the finish line. Use various power-ups to disturb the opponents! Enjoy and have fun in playing this free online 3D racing game. Good luck.

Also make sure to check out Raccoon Racing Game, you may enjoy playing it.

Play Stallion’s Spirit Game